Perks were up the net runner tree, up the tactical tree (Bolt.) and body+ dash in reflexes.
Weapons were a tech revolver that shot two shots, each exploded, and caused the target to burn, the burn made all shots crits. The net running abilities were, reboot optics, weapon glitch, cripple movement, cyberware malfunction, sonic shock, memory wipe, cyber psychosis and short circuit.
For Adam Smasher, it was simply making use of the dash to avoid his attacks, cripple movementing him, tossing a thermal grenade to do extra damage to his armor and shooting him in his weakpoints. For the Maxtech patrols from the 5 stars, it was using the right tool for the job. In this case, it was cripple movement+cyberware malfunction (Two times to destroy cyberware.) the mantis blade girl. Weapon glitch the heavy, reboot optic the sniper. Complete as needed.
Cyberware was a mixture of high armor (Ended with 984 of 1500) and general utilization and make sure to get the blood pump+auto use health item. Adrenaline is also super important as this prevents auto using your health item over and over per hit.
